Gather Clear Evidence That Bans AI Rejections
The first concrete step is collecting undeniable proof to challenge inaccuracies. Think of this as gathering puzzle pieces from different angles—your bank statements, official notices, or legal documents—that paint a clear picture of your credit history. For example, I once faced a medical debt error, and I compiled hospital bills and insurance correspondence to substantiate my claim. This evidence is your weapon against AI’s superficial review, which often dismiss vague disputes. To learn advanced techniques on how to gather compelling proof, visit this guide.
Photo Evidence and Official Letters
Photos of bills, correspondence, or even signed agreements can act as irrefutable proof. When disputing an erroneous inquiry, a screenshot of your authorization or consent can make your case unstoppable. Use high-resolution images to ensure clarity and avoid AI misinterpretation. Remember, precise and obvious evidence short-circuits AI’s algorithmic dismissals.
Create a Dispute Package That AI Can’t Ignore
This step is akin to packaging a gift with explosive clarity—every item included should tell a story to the reviewer. Begin with a cover letter that explicitly outlines each disputed item, referencing your attached evidence. For each point, include a brief explanation supported by your documents, making it irrefutable. When I did this, I noticed a massive shift: the bureau’s automated system paused, and I was flagged for manual review, often leading to successful corrections.
Use Certified Mail for Maximum Impact
Sending your dispute package via certified mail with tracking not only provides proof of delivery but also signals seriousness. This step pressures bureaus to allocate human review over dismissing cases as frivolous AI judgments. Plus, it establishes a legal trail that can be invaluable if disputes escalate to legal proceedings.
Leverage Two-Way Communication to Keep the Process Alive
Don’t let your dispute stagnate in AI limbo. Follow up with the credit bureaus regularly, referencing your original case number and attaching previous correspondence. Consistent, documented contact pressures the institution to resolve and ensures your case remains active. When I persisted with routine follow-ups, I cut through AI delays and achieved correction in record time.
Appeal and Escalate to Human Review When Necessary
If your dispute is rejected again, don’t give up. Use a formal appeal letter emphasizing your enclosed evidence and request a manual review. In my experience, this tactic often triggers a human behind the scenes to reevaluate the case, leading to successful amendments. For detailed strategies on pushing disputes to manual reviews, explore this resource.
Track, Document, and Refine Your Approach Continually
Maintain a detailed log of all correspondence, evidence sent, and responses received. This record allows you to identify patterns, optimize your evidence collection, and anticipate bureau responses. Regularly refining your methods increases your success rate and keeps you steps ahead of AI’s evolving tactics. My own ongoing tracking system helped me close disputes faster and with higher accuracy, turning a frustrating process into a strategic game.
